Zipped (compressed) files take up less storage space and can be transferred to other computers more quickly than uncompressed files. Zip and unzip files - Microsoft Support Microsoft Support en-gb windows zip- Microsoft Support en-gb windows zip-
Right-click on the file or folder. Move your cursor over the Send to option. This will open a new submenu. Select Compressed (zipped) folder. To place multiple files into a zip folder, select all of the files while hitting the Ctrl button. With a glue stick, you can stick your zipper to the seam. Apply glue on each side of the zipper tape and carefully place the zipper on top of your seam, teeth down. The zipper coil should line up perfectly down the center of the seam. Press firmly, and let the glue set for a couple of minutes.
Place the zipper along the basted portion of the seam, aligning the teeth so they are centered with the seam. Make sure the zipper stop is just above the zipper stop mark. Pin into place.
